# Q3 Cash-Flow Forecast — Managers Only

Graywick Foods projects a modest cash surplus for Q3, driven by the Pellam distribution deal and reduced packaging costs. Receivables from the Norbridge accounts remain slow; collections effort continues. Capital spending is frozen except the cold-storage upgrade. Department heads should plan hiring against these constraints. A confidential note on forward business plans is appended directly below this page.

board note of tadup-tajog: Headcount on the Oliiel team goes from 31 to 88 by the end of February. Gross margin on Oliiel came in at 62 percent against a plan of 29 percent.

## 2024-11 Key Rotation — Halcyon Guide

Rotated the release signing key for the Halcyon audio-guide app after the Merrow Museum pilot flagged an expiring certificate. Old builds remain valid until the grace window closes Friday; new uploads must be signed with the replacement key or the kiosk sync service will reject them. If a venue reports failed tour downloads overnight, check the signer version first, then re-trigger the sync job. The current release signing key is below.

rollout seal: bky4_DFM9

Churn Review — Pilot Programme "Lanternline" (Managers Only)

Prepared for the board of Quayveris Ltd. Of 212 pilot customers in the Ostbury region, 31 cancelled within eight weeks — roughly double forecast. Exit interviews point to onboarding friction and unclear billing, not the product itself. Corrective steps: simplified setup flow, revised invoice layout, proactive check-in calls at day ten. Early signs after remediation are encouraging. A confidential note on next steps follows.

board note of kageg-bahof: The renewal with Holwynax Holdings closes at $2 million a year, 5 percent below the last contract. Project Ulaath slips by two quarters because of the supplier delay.

# Handover: Thumbnail queue (Pixelforge)

Welcome aboard. The thumbnail generation queue in Pixelforge is the touchiest part of the media pipeline, so please read this carefully before touching it. Jobs arrive from the upload service, get resized by the Shrinkwell workers, and land in the cold store. If the backlog exceeds a few thousand, scale workers before anything else — never purge the queue, as retries are not idempotent for animated formats. The workers read the following configuration at startup.

service settings:
[casax]
port = 6379
team = rusir
host = casax.zemvarhq.corp
region = outer-4
access_code = ac_9808ce
timeout_ms = 1500